- This is a combined synopsis/solicitation for commercial items prepared in accordance with the format in Subpart 12.6, as supplemented with additional information included in this notice. This announcement constitutes the only solicitation; proposals are being requested and a written solicitation will not be issued. MONTANA NATIONAL GUARD This is a combined synopsis/solicitation for commercial items prepared in accordance with the format in the Federal Acquisition Regulations (FAR) Subpart 12.6, as supplemented with additional information included in this notice. This announcement constitutes the only solicitation; quotes are being requested and a written solicitation will not be issued. This request is a hundred percent set aside for small business concerns. The NAICS code is 722320 and the size standard is less than $7.0 million. The incorporated provisions and clauses are those in effect through Federal Acquisition Circular 2005-26, effective 1 June 2008 & Class Deviation 2005-00001. Offers shall propose a firm fixed price for approximately 6,405 breakfast and 6,395 dinner meals served at Fort Harrison building 410 or 411 starting with dinner on Mar 4th, 2012 through breakfast on Apr 1st, 2012. Vendor shall propose a firm fixed price PER MEAL for each of the two categories of catered meals - breakfast and dinner prepared in accordance with the attached statement of work. Synopsis: 1.The quality and serving portions of the meals must be equivalent to commercially available prepared meals and will comply with the attached statement of work. Substitutions of menu items must be of equal quality and value. Changes to items will be communicated and coordinated with the POC. 2.The vendor is responsible for serving and portion control. Buffet style serving is preferred. Ala carte ordering is prohibited. 3.Meal pricing must include all overhead, delivery, set-up and clean-up costs. Gratuity is prohibited. 4.Vendor will invoice meals by date and type. 5.Unit Point of Contact (POC) will provide vendor with head count personnel and sign-in sheets for meals. Participants will sign a different sign-in sheet for each meal. POC will coordinate with vendor to adjust number of meals as necessary. 6.Fort Harrison DOES NOT have facilities to prepare catered meals on site. Mobile field kitchen with food preparation capability is preferred. No government furnished equipment will be provided to the contractor. The provision of 52.212-3 Alt I, Offeror Representations and Certifications-Commercial Items (April 2002) applies to this RFQ. 52.212-3 Alt I clause needs to be completed and a signed copy of this provision shall be submitted with any offer. 52.212-2, Evaluation-- Commercial Items (January 1999). The Government will award a contract resulting from this solicitation to the responsible offeror whose offer conforming to the solicitation will represent the best value to the Government. The best value determination will be made by evaluating the contractor's offer based on Price and Past Performance, where Price and Past Performance are approximately equal. Offerors may submit no more than three (3) past performance narratives demonstrating the ability to serve catered meals to up to500 personnel.
